Orchestrating Human-AI Software Delivery: A Retrospective Longitudinal Field Study of Three Software Modernization Programs

Most AI tools improve how individuals write code. But enterprise software is delivered by teams—across planning, implementation, validation, and release.

This paper presents a benchmark study of agentic software delivery across three real-world modernization programs and five delivery models. The results show what happens when AI agents are orchestrated across the full software development lifecycle, working alongside human teams in a shared system.

The outcome: faster delivery, lower engineering effort, and higher first-release quality.
